Durable Materials Guide for PNW Climate Outdoor Kitchens

Stainless Steel Cabinetry Performance

Choosing weatherproof metal storage is a smart move for Bellevue climates where dampness can warp lesser materials. These cabins provide top-tier corrosion protection when adequately installed. Paired with sealed seams and elevated bases, they block mold prevention in outdoor spaces.

  • Choose 304 or 316-grade marine-grade metal
  • Confirm all fasteners are stainless

Bellevue Zoning Rules and Regulations

Knowing setback requirements prevents costly redesigns or forced removals after construction. Most outdoor kitchens must be set back at least 5–10 feet from property lines, and coverage limits may apply depending on lot size. These regulations help preserve sunlight access and minimize disputes.

A licensed contractor King County can assess your site against current zoning maps.

Year-Round Care and Upkeep

Protecting Against Freezing Conditions

When guarding against your outdoor kitchen remodeling from Bellevue’s freeze-thaw cycle, proper shutting down is mandatory. Drain water lines, unplug gas connections, and shield all fixtures with insulated covers.

Skipping this routine could lead to costly failures—especially in systems with refrigeration.

Preventing Mold in Damp Climates

With Bellevue’s humidity, moisture control is vital for longevity. Build with slope grading beneath and around your countertops to limit stagnant water.

Use mold-resistant sealants and sealed concrete to block spore development in high-moisture zones.
